Storage Devices

Storage devices are essential components of computer systems responsible for retaining digital data. They enable both temporary and permanent data storage, allowing computers to boot, run programs, and save user information.

How Storage Devices Work

Storage devices store digital data as binary information (0s and 1s). HDDs use magnetic fields on disks, while SSDs use electrical charges stored in non-volatile memory cells. Optical drives rely on lasers to interpret pattern reflections on discs.

Choosing the Right Storage Device

When selecting a storage device, consider factors such as speed, capacity, durability, and cost. SSDs offer superior performance and reliability but tend to be more expensive, while HDDs provide large storage volumes at lower prices.

Storage Technologies on the Horizon

Emerging technologies like NVMe, 3D NAND, and persistent memory continue to enhance storage speed and efficiency, driving innovation in data storage for future computing needs.
